Output 121e9754ba058d5e472ebc83522db5251ad6cfa2c334b9440d0a3b57d120064b:2

value
34353903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b614288c25f5bb7d206fa01a9d42c8dfc38fd1f OP_EQUAL
address
3QcC3RrxtrtsXx27ebL1WUMgyBVWebhQUk
transaction
121e9754ba058d5e472ebc83522db5251ad6cfa2c334b9440d0a3b57d120064b
spent
true